Tianjin Municipal Government Scholarship


Program Category: Full-time On-Campus Master’s Students

Eligibility Requirements

Eligibility Requirements: Applicants must be non-Chinese citizens, in good health, and demonstrate excellent academic and ethical conduct.

Academic Requirements:

Applicants for master’s programs must hold an academic qualification equivalent to a Chinese bachelor’s degree and be under 35 years of age.

Language Requirements: Applicants for master’s programs must possess at least HSK Level 4 Chinese proficiency. Their Chinese language level must meet the entry requirements of the respective academic programs.

Application Procedure:

Application Deadline: June 15, 2025


Application Procedure:

Step 1: Online Application

1. Apply online via the International Student Office website.

Log in to Tianjin University of Technology’s International Student Application System (https://tjut.at0086.cn/StuApplication/Login.aspx) and complete the online form.

2. Upload the Tianjin Municipal Government Scholarship Application Form to the system.


Application Documents:

1. Application Form for the Tianjin University of Technology Scholarship for New International Students

2. Notarized highest academic diploma or a pre-graduation certificate

3. Academic transcripts

4. Proof of language proficiency

5. Foreigner Physical Examination Form

6. Certificate of No Criminal Record

7. Two recommendation letters written in Chinese or English from associate professors or higher in relevant fields

Special Notes:

● Faxed application materials will not be accepted.

● Incomplete or falsified application materials will not be accepted.

● There is no need to mail hard copies of the application documents. However, the university or the relevant school/department reserves the right to request the original documents or certified copies issued by designated authentication agencies for further verification.


Step 2: Track Your Application Status Online

You can check the progress and status of your application through your registered email or the Tianjin University of Technology International Student Application System.

Please make sure your email address is correct and check your inbox regularly to avoid missing important notifications (such as interview invitations, etc.).


Step 3: Admission and Enrollment

You can check your admission results through the Tianjin University of Technology International Student Application System or by visiting the announcement section of the International Student Office website. Admitted students must report to the university and complete registration strictly according to the date specified in the Admission Notice. At registration, original documents such as the diploma and degree certificate will be verified. Applicants who fail to obtain the required certificates will have their admission canceled.


Important Notes:

1. If any application materials are found to be falsified or not personally completed and submitted by the applicant, the application eligibility will be revoked immediately.

2. Scholarship recipients who are unable to register on time must inform the university in writing at least 15 days before the registration date, stating the reason. Those who fail to report without a valid reason will have their scholarship qualification canceled.

3. Students who fail the entrance medical examination, withdraw, or suspend their studies will have their scholarship eligibility revoked.
